WIX Filters Adds 87 New Product Numbers in First Quarter of 2009

WIX Filters made available to its customers 87 new product numbers across light-duty, heavy-duty and industrial applications in the first quarter of 2009. Filters for foreign nameplate applications led the list, with more than 35 new air, oil, cabin air and fuel filter product numbers for Mazda, Honda, Hyundai, BMW, Porsche, Audi and Volkswagen, among other brands.

“In the first quarter of 2009 our ongoing line expansion placed an emphasis on new filters for foreign nameplate brands and our new WIX/NoToil Filters for motocross and ATV applications,” said Patrick Enniss, product development manager for WIX Filters. “Our engineers and product development department strive every day to provide our customers with the best possible filtration options for vehicles and machinery in every sector, which leads to the creation of more than six new WIX Filters’ product numbers each week.”
      
The new filters in the first quarter of 2009 include air, cabin air, fuel, hydraulic and transmission filters covering applications from John Deere Tractors and Cummins Engines to Mini Coopers and the new Hyundai Genesis. Air Conditioning Odor Causes

Air conditioning odors typically result from the uncontrolled growth of bacteria and other microorganisms in the evaporator. Research by independent laboratories has found fungi such as Aspergillus, Cladesporium, Penicillium and others growing on cooling coils and other A/C system areas.
